N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ING ON PROPOSAL FOR AN AMENDMENT TO MODIFY THE SCOPE AND INCREASE IN THE ESTIMATED MAXIMUM COST OF THE DOWNSVILLE WATER DISTRICT IMPROVEMENT PROJECT

Notice is hereby given that the Town Board of the Town of Colchester, Delaware County, will meet at the Town Hall, 72 Tannery Road, Downsville, New York 13755, on the 27th day of January, 2021, at 7 o’clock p.m., prevailing time, for the purpose of conducting a public hearing upon a proposal by said Town Board to modify the project scope and increase the estimated maximum cost for the improvement and modification of the facilities of Downsville Water District pursuant to Section 202-b of the Town Law as hereinafter described, at which time and place said Town Board will meet to consider such proposition and hear all persons interested in the subject thereof and concerning the same.
The Town Board previously approved a recommended work plan for improvements to Downsville Water District as described in the Preliminary Engineering Report dated February 2017, as amended September 20, 2019 prepared by Delaware Engineering, P.C., including construction of a new water filtration plant for the existing spring source, and including original furnishings, equipment, machinery and apparatus required therefor. The Engineer has prepared a further amendment dated January 5, 2021, for an expansion of the project scope to include the acquisition and installation of approximately 125 water meters and an increase in the estimated maximum amount proposed to be expended for the improvements to $601,476. Such original Engineer’s report as amended in 2019 and the 2021 amendment are on file in the Town Clerk’s office for public inspection.
The Town Board as lead agency has previously determined that the project as described in the original Engineer’s report constitutes an unlisted action as defined under the State Environmental Quality Review Regulations, 6 NYCRR Part 617, which has been determined under SEQRA not to have a significant impact on the environment.

New York State Department of Environmental Conservation
Notice of Complete
Application

Date:
01/05/2021
Applicant:
RCS LLC 315 Old Rte 10 Deposit, NY 13754
Facility:
Roods Creek Quarry Roods Creek Rd- W Side - S of St Rte 30 Deposit, NY 13754
Application ID:
4-1299-00035/00001
Permit(s) Applied for:
1- Article 23 Title 27 Mined Land Reclamation 1- Article 15 Title 15 Water Withdrawal Non-public
Project is located:
In Multiple Towns in Delaware County
Project Description:
The applicant proposes to modify an existing 19.9 acre life-of-mine bluestone mined land reclamation permit to lower the mine floor elevation to 1,750 amsl in a 1.7 acre portion of a 2.9 acre drop cut and the backfill up tp 1,800 amsl at final reclamtion. The withdrawal of a supply of water up to 761,250 gallons per day for the operation of the quarry for on-site mining and dust control is also proposed. Existing authorized processing at the site includes crushing and screening, mechanical cutting and blasting. There are no changes proposed to the level of activity or mining methods for the proposed modification. The project is located on Roods Creek Road approximately 0.7 miles south of State Route 10, in the Towns of Tompkins and Deposit, Delaware County.
Availability of Application Documents:
Filed application documents, and Department draft permits where applicable, are available for inspection during normal business hours at the address of the contact person. To ensure timely service at the time of inspection, is recommended that an appointment be made with the contact person.
State Environment Quality Review (SEQR)
Determination
Project is a Unlisted Action and will not have a significant impact on the environment. A Negative Declaration is on file. A coordinated review was performed.
SEQR Lead Agency:
NYS Department of Environmental Conservation.
State Historic Preservation Act (SHPA) Determination:
Cultural resource lists and maps have been checked. The proposed activity is not in an area of identified archaeological sensitivity and no known registered, eligible or inventoried archaeological sites or historic structures were identified or documented for the project location. No further review in accordance with SHPA is required.
